Hordeolum internum (Q41524)

A focal acute pyogenic infection, usually by Staphylococcus aureus, of a meibomian gland, the normal secretion from which into the eyelash follicle is blocked. It presents as an acute inflammatory swelling which may discharge onto the conjunctival surface of the eyelid, or rarely anteriorly through the eyelid skin. It may predispose to formation of a chalazion.
